Glenice's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Splitting Glenice's full recorded timeline at 1939, 47%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 53% in the earlier half -- a fairly even split across the full record. Its quietest year on record was 1907,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1931 peak of 30 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Glenice?
Glenice has been given to 943 babies in the U.S. since 1907, according to SSA data. Its archive ordinal is #7,826 of 72,339 among girls' names (total births, highest first). Its last appearance in the data was 1968. 30 babies were born in 1931, its single highest year.
Where does Glenice sit in the SSA name archive?
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Glenice ranks #7,826 of 72,339 girls' names by all-time recorded births (highest first). All-time ordinal matches browse popularity (total births DESC); the current ordinal uses the null SSA file. See /methodology#corpus-placement.
When was Glenice most popular?
Glenice was most popular in the 1920s decade with 223 total births. The single peak year was 1931.
Where is Glenice most popular?
The top states for the name Glenice are Maine (35 births), Virginia (6 births), Minnesota (5 births).
How long has the name Glenice been used?
The SSA has tracked Glenice since 1907 -- 62 years through the most recent 1968 data.
